hi sp! there are two ways to settle your debts. you can directly negotiate with the collection agencies or you can hire a professional debt consolidation firm. for that you need to pay them for their services. if the loan amount is small then you may choose to do it yourself. but in case you have multiple debts totalling to a huge amount, then my advice to you would be to hire a professional debt consolidation form. these people, if they really know their job, can reduce to about 50% of what you currently owe, by deducting all the extras. there is a lot of pressure to handle while dealing with the collection agencies and the consolidating firms are well equiped to deal with it.
but you should be very careful before deciding on a particular debt consolidation firm. there are too many scams in this profession. do not be taken in by the advertisements. you may be making your monthly payments to them regularly, and yet you may find out later that the payments were naver made to your original creditors, and then you will have to pay up all over again. do a thorough research and then move ahead. good luck!

Laurel is correct. Anyone can do their own debt settlement. There are professional companies out there for a reason though. Dealing with these creditors can be very stressful and cause more anxiety then it is worth. Reputable Settlement Companies will help end collection calls and creditor harrassment, they will cut your payments usually by 50% or you can choose to pay what you have been paying in one payment and pay off your debt even quicker. They also negotiate with the same creditors daily and have more leverage than the average consumer. So if you are in over your head, like most people are that hire debt settlement companies, you may save yourself from alot of stress and anxiety by letting the professionals work for you.
If you decide to hire a professional, be sure you look for a reputable, trustworthy company. You should know at all times where your money is going and who they have been negotiating with. Service is #1 when hiring a settlement company. If you do not have access to that kind of information throughout your program, find a company that offers it!
